Jack Savoretti announces Belfast and Dublin shows
The British-Italian songwriter will play Ulster Hall on November 2 and 3Olympia November 3.
British-Italian songwriter Jack Savoretti has announced shows in Belfast's Ulster Hall on November 2 and in Dublin’s 3Olympia Theatre on November 3.
It follows the announcement of his upcoming ninth album We Will Always Be The Way We Were, due out on April 10. It marks 20 years since his debut album Between the Minds, and was written and recorded with his long-time touring band at Eastcote Studios in West London.
“This is a full-circle album,” says Savoretti. “It’s going back to my roots, to the neighbourhood where I first started making music - with the same friends and musicians I met around Ladbroke Grove and Portobello Road. It’s the album I always wanted to make when I was starting out, but didn’t yet have the courage or experience to make. Now I do.”

The upcoming Irish show comes as part of a huge 29-date UK and European tour, marking his biggest run of shows yet.
It will open in Athens on September 25, before travelling through a further ten countries across Europe and arriving in the UK on October 21 to play Plymouth Pavilions. The UK and Ireland leg includes 15 dates, with shows in Glasgow, Belfast, Cardiff, Gateshead, Manchester and more.
